Senior Manager, Head of Middle East Communications

a couple of women smiling

Description

Role Description:

We are seeking a senior communications leader to drive a holistic communications program in the Middle East. The role touches all internal and external audiences including employees, customers, media and partners, helping the business confidently to tell its story.

Responsibilities:

  • Communications Strategy: Partner with the international and global communications teams to oversee the development and execution of a communications strategy for the Middle East that will secure and expand awareness and reputation for Salesforce across the market.

  • Strategic counsel and leadership: Sit on the Middle East Leadership Team providing strategic communications counsel to the Senior Vice-President and General Manager, Salesforce Middle East, the business and act as a go-to point of escalation for all communications issues.

  • Executive Communications: Oversee executive communications programs for our regional leader and other senior executives with bold and authentic narratives and internal and external engagement programs.

  • Narrative and key message development: Build the company narrative for the Middle East, enable the extended teams to tell the story of Salesforce in a way that resonates in the local market, inspires our customers to think big and take action, and promotes brand love across a broad set of audiences.

  • Media relations: Manage our engagements with the media and oversee our PR agency team.

  • Employee communications: Partner with the employee comms team to ensure our employee programming aligns with the Middle East Leadership Team's priorities.

  • Policy Comms: Collaborate with our Marketing, Government Affairs, Privacy and Legal teams in the region and lead the development of thought-leadership campaigns and engagement.

  • Operations: Support the management processes around budgeting, reporting and other global alignment programs.

Required Skills & Experience:

  • 10+ years experience in (internal and external) communications roles

  • Established direct relationships across the business and technology media

  • Experience in representing and engaging in industry organizations

  • Exposure to managing key stakeholder relationships

  • Excellent leadership skills and experience in working across a matrix organisation to bring people together and deliver a strategy

  • Impeccable critical thinking and no ego - we are a dynamic team and everyone pitches in to get the job done

  • Ability to thrive in a fast-paced environment while multitasking, re-prioritizing projects and communicating priority updates to business partners

  • Fluent in Arabic and English
